In marketing, storytelling isn’t about exaggeration or performance. It’s not about crafting something that feels bigger or flashier than reality. It’s about authenticity, intention, and connection. It’s about uncovering what’s already there and helping bring it forward in a way that feels honest and true.

When we take the time to understand a brand’s story, we begin to see the deeper layers. We learn about the reasons someone started in the first place. Storytelling doesn’t have to be complicated. Sometimes it’s as simple as highlighting the people behind the work, the community that supports it, or the journey that led to where things are today. It can live in the words on a website, the visuals in a video, or the captions on a social post. What matters most is that it reflects something true.

When we say, “It’s Your Story. Let’s Tell It Together,” we mean that the story already exists. Our role isn’t to create it from scratch. Our role is to listen, to ask thoughtful questions, and to help shape it into something that feels clear, meaningful, and worth sharing.

At Vincent Design, storytelling is not a step in our process, it’s the foundation of it. As an Indigenous-led organization, we approach every project with the understanding that stories carry history, identity, and purpose. Before we think about visuals, campaigns, or strategy, we take the time to listen. We learn where our clients come from, what shaped their work, and what they hope to build moving forward. That listening phase is where the most meaningful marketing begins.

Because at the end of the day, the strongest brands aren’t built on trends or tactics alone. They’re built on stories that help people feel connected,  to the work, to the purpose, and to the people behind it all.
